The Ideal Material Profile for Impact Crushing

Impact crushers work by hurling material against hard surfaces or aprons using high-speed rotors with blow bars. This crushing action is most effective on materials that are:

Medium to hard, but not extremely abrasive.

Brittle, meaning they fracture easily upon impact.

Thanks to this principle, mobile impact crushers excel at producing a well-shaped, cubical end product.

Key Material Types for Mobile Impact Crushers

1. Limestone and Other Medium-Hard Sedimentary Rocks
This is the classic application for impact crushers. Limestone is relatively soft and non-abrasive, allowing the crusher to achieve high reduction ratios and produce a high-quality product ideal for concrete and asphalt aggregates.

2. Recycled Concrete and Construction & Demolition (C&D) Waste
Mobile impact crushers are the go-to solution for concrete recycling. They efficiently break down concrete slabs, rubble, and other C&D debris into valuable recycled aggregate. The built-in magnetic separator often removes rebar automatically, streamlining the process.

3. Asphalt and Asphalt Milling
Similar to concrete, reclaimed asphalt pavement (RAP) is perfectly suited for mobile impact crushing. The crusher can process large chunks of asphalt into a uniform, reusable material for new road base or asphalt production.

4. Sandstone and Non-Abrasive Igneous Rocks
While extremely hard and abrasive rocks like granite and basalt are better suited for cone crushers, mobile impact crushers can still process them, especially if they are not the primary feed material. However, wear costs will be higher.

Materials to Approach with Caution

While versatile, mobile impact crushers are not universal crushers. Some materials can cause excessive wear or damage:

Highly Abrasive Materials: Continuous processing of very hard, silica-rich rocks (like some quartzite or trap rock) will rapidly wear down blow bars and liners, increasing operational costs.

Metals: While they can handle embedded rebar in concrete, pure metal streams (like scrap metal) are not suitable and can cause severe damage.

Very Hard Rock: For dedicated, high-tonnage crushing of hard granite or basalt, a mobile jaw and cone crusher combination is often more efficient and economical in the long run.

The Ultimate Advantage: On-Site Versatility

The true power of a mobile impact crusher lies in its mobility combined with this material versatility. A single machine can be used to:

Process a stockpile of limestone at a quarry.

Move to a demolition site to recycle concrete.

Crush asphalt millings directly on a road construction project.

This flexibility maximizes equipment utilization and return on investment.
